Family Star: A Shining Performance Overshadowed by a Fading Script


“Family Star,” the latest Telugu film by Parasuram Petla, starring Vijay Deverakonda and Mrunal Thakur, has hit the theaters. While the movie generates buzz for its star power, the question remains – does it deliver a stellar performance or fall short? Let’s delve into a detailed review.

The Story at the Heart

“Family Star” centers around Govardhan (Deverakonda), a middle-class man who shoulders the responsibility of his entire family. The narrative explores his struggles and sacrifices as he strives to keep his loved ones happy. Enter Sanyuktha (Thakur), who brings a spark into Govardhan’s life. However, their budding romance faces challenges as they navigate family dynamics and societal pressures.

Hits and Misses

The film shines in its portrayal of family life. Deverakonda delivers a heartfelt performance, capturing the essence of a man dedicated to his family. The camaraderie and conflicts within the joint family resonate with viewers, especially those familiar with Indian social structures. Mrunal Thakur complements Deverakonda well, adding a touch of glamour and charm.

However, the script falters in its execution. The plot lacks originality, with predictable twists and turns. The humor, while clean, feels forced at times. The emotional depth that a family drama promises is missing, leaving viewers wanting more. The pacing also drags in the second half, with unnecessary song placements disrupting the narrative flow.

Technical Aspects: A Mixed Bag

The technical aspects of “Family Star” are decent. The cinematography is good, capturing the essence of both urban and rural settings. The music by Gopi Sundar is pleasant but fails to create a lasting impact. The editing could have been tighter to maintain a crisp narrative.

The Final Verdict: A Watchable Affair with Reservations

“Family Star” is a watchable film, particularly for fans of Vijay Deverakonda and Mrunal Thakur. Their performances are the saving grace of the movie. However, the lackluster script and predictable plot hold it back from being a truly memorable experience.

Do You Recommend It?

If you’re looking for a light-hearted family drama with good performances, “Family Star” might be a decent one-time watch. But if you crave a more impactful and engaging story, you might want to look elsewhere.
